Association des Parents et des Enseignantes et Enseignants de l'Ecole Vision Jeunesse de Vanier Inc. is a charitable organization based in Ottawa, Ontario, classified by the CRA under support of schools and education. In its fiscal year ending December 31, 2022, it reported $42K in revenue and $47K in expenditures. Spending exceeded revenue that year — the gap came out of reserves.

Its funding that year was roughly 100% from donations. In 2023, 1 other registered charity reported granting it a combined $200.

Compared with 4,037 education charities of similar size, its share of spending on mission — charitable programs plus grants to other charities — ranked above 58% of peers.

Revenue has grown substantially over its filings on record here, from $15K in 2020 to $42K in 2022. Its filed list of directors and trustees shows 8 names.
